1. Introduction
The IP KVM Matrix System is a solution that combines KFH Series KVM extenders
(KFH151S/E, KFH151L, KFH251S), with the IP KVM Matrix System to extend, control, and
monitor access to computers, across a Local Area Network(LAN), in a multitude of ways.
The system lets you set up a matrix of remote KVM consoles that access computers across
a LAN, with the flexibility to control and configure each connection.
The high-performance KFH extenders consist of a transmitter and a receiver. The
transmitter connects to a computer to deliver the computer’s data to the receiver to
collectively provide console access from a remote or separate location. The computer can
be accessed via a network or direct Ethernet cable connection from the remote console.
The KFH extenders support flawless and lossless video compression quality with
ultra-low latency, Latency as low as 16 milliseconds, and resolution up to
3840x2160@30Hz.
The extenders have a local On Screen Display (OSD) on the receiver end in configuring
both the receiver and transmitter —for easy setup and operation.
The extenders can connect unit-to-unit or over a network via Gigabit Ethernet or the
SFP ports. Connecting both methods allows network failover.
When working without the DC-SG centralized management, the IP KVM Matrix
extenders feature the Slim Matrix Mode that makes up to 40 units (Tx & Rx ).
IP KVM Matrix Extenders allow flexible setup as they can make console-to-computer
connections in several ways: one-to-one (Extender mode), one-to-many (Splitter mode),
many-to-one (Switch mode), or many-to-many (Matrix mode).
The IP KVM Matrix Manager (DC-SG) allows you to define the aforementioned matrix
connections and manage KFH extenders with features such as auto-detection of KFH
extenders, username/password authentication, switching and sharing of connections,
permissions, and more. Whether you're extending computer access for Monitoring, Editing,
or Workstation setup, the IP KVM Matrix System gives you the flexibility and control to
manage one or hundreds of extended connections.

1.1 Function
This product is to extend and switch USB peripherals such as keyboards, mouse, U
disks, and video signals. As a professional product, it must not be used in any potentially
explosive situations.
Please use this product in accordance with the instructions in this manual. Any use
not in accordance with the instructions in this manual is considered as abnormal use. The
product connected to the PC side is sender (TX), and to the monitor is receiver (RX).
1.2 Feature
HDMI / USB2.0/Audio/Rs232 - IP KVM Matrix Extenders
Flawless and lossless video compression quality with ultra-low latency(<1
frame/sec.)
Supports standard resolutions from 640 x 480 to 3840x2160@30Hz
OSD (On Screen Display) on the Receiver configures Tx / Rx devices
Gigabit Ethernet port
USB 2.0 over IP for KVM application
Seamless and fast switching
Supports connection via Gigabit Ethernet port (RJ-45) or SFP port for failover
RS-232 serial ports allow you to connect to a serial terminal for configuration and
serial devices such as touchscreens and barcode scanners
Supports digital audio/ analog audio Hybrid Mode
Direct connection- via a CAT6 cable, you can also connect the transmitter to
multiple receivers and vice versa; each point can be supported by the unit up to
4(KFH251S)
Connection via a Hub/switch - supports up to 40 units. Moreover, with the IP KVM
Matrix Manager (DC-SG), it supports up to 9999 units(Tx & Rx)
Remote login security
Supports Power over Ethernet (PoE) functionality(KFH151E-TX)
HDMI OUT loopback port on Transmitter(Tx)
Hot pluggable, Upgradeable firmware
Intelligent Dual Video Output Management —split two video sources from a dual
display Transmitter and connect to each from different
Receivers(KFH251S-TX/KFH251S-RX)
VGA connection, local USB loop out, remote USB ON/OFF, remote powering on/off
(KFH151L-TX/KFH151L-RX)
Supports CAT5e/6/7 transmission. The longest point-to-point extension distance is
up to 120m
